Cal Poly Alumna to Lead May 30 Workshop on STEM Students Creating Social Change

Cal Poly alumna Devon Buddan will lead a workshop, “Medicine, Race and Gender: A STEM Students for Social Change Workshop” from 11 a.m. to 1 p.m. Friday, May 30, in Room 204 in the University Union on campus.  

Buddan will address what it means to be a student who faces social, educational and/or economic barriers to careers in science, technology, engineering and mathematics (STEM), with a particular focus on pre-medical pathways. The workshop is intended to provide a safe space for students to discuss their experiences in college and beyond and to develop ideas about how STEM students can participate in change on and off campus.

Buddan holds a bachelor’s degree in comparative ethnic studies from Cal Poly’s College of Liberal Arts. She is enrolled in the pre-health studies certificate program at Cal State East Bay and plans to attend medical school. She will discuss aspects of her own career path during the course of the presentation.

The workshop is sponsored by the statewide Louis Stokes Alliance for Minority and Underrepresented Student Participation (LSAMP) Program and Cal Poly’s Student Academic Services’ Connections for Academic Success Program and Partners ProgramCross Cultural CenterCollege of Science & Mathematics’ Pre-Health Advising, and the Biological SciencesEthnic Studies, and Kinesiology departments. 

The LSAMP Program is dedicated to increasing the number of students from underrepresented groups that graduate from the California State University system with degrees in STEM disciplines. LSAMP is supported by the National Science Foundation Grant No. HRD-0802628 and the CSU Chancellor's Office and coordinated by Cal Poly’s Center for Excellence in STEM Education.

The event is free and open to the public. Lunch will be provided.
